How Our Moisture Detection Services Work
When you call our team, we’ll send a trained technician to your home to assess the situation. They’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den water damage, identify the source of the problem, and develop a customized drying plan to get your home back to normal.
Step 1: Moisture Detection
Our technician will use a moisture meter to scan your home for signs of water damage. This helps us identify areas that may be affected and focus on our drying efforts.
Step 2: Source Identification
We’ll use infrared cameras and other specialized tools to identify the source of the water damage. This helps us develop a plan to fix the issue and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Containment
Our team will set up containment barriers to prevent further damage and ensure that the affected area remains dry during the drying process.
Step 4: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, removing excess moisture and preventing further damage.
Step 5: Final Inspection
Our technician will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the drying process was successful and that your home is safe and dry.

Warning Signs You Need Moisture Detection Services
Ignoring moisture damage can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Here are some common warning signs that you need moisture detection services: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ell in your home can show hidden water damage.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ect the source of the odor and develop a plan to fix the issue.
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of hidden water damage. Our team will use infrared cameras and moisture meters to detect the source of the problem and develop a customized drying plan.
Puddles on the Floor
A puddle on the floor can be a sign of a more serious issue.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ect the source of the water and develop a plan to fix the problem.
Peeling Paint or Warped Wood
Peeling paint or warped wood can show hidden water damage.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ect the source of the problem and develop a plan to fix the issue.

Common Questions About Moisture Detection Services
Q: What causes moisture damage in homes?
A: Moisture dam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including leaks, condensation, and flooding.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ect the source of the problem and develop a plan to fix it.
Q: How long does it take to dry out a home after water damage?
A: The drying time will depend on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will work with you to develop a customized drying plan and provide regular updates on the progress.
Q: Is it safe to live in a home with moisture damage?
A: No, it’s not safe to live in a home with moisture damage. Hidden water damage can cause significant health and safety hazards, including mold growth, structural damage, and electrical issues. Our team will work with you to develop a plan to fix the issue and make your home safe and healthy again.
Q: Can I try to fix moisture damage myself?
A: No, it’s not recommended to try to fix moisture damage yourself. Hidden water damage can be difficult to detect and need specialized equipment and expertise to fix. Our team has the training and experience to detect and repair moisture damage quickly and efficiently.
Q: How do I prevent moisture damage in my home?
A: To prevent moisture damage in your home, make sure to regularly inspect your home for signs of water damage, fix leaks quickly, and maintain your home’s ventilation and insulation systems. Our team can also provide recommendations on how to prevent moisture damage in your specific situation.
